Product Introduction

Overview

The LTC2293CUP, produced by Analog Devices Inc., is a high-performance, dual 12-bit analog-to-digital converter (ADC) designed for digitizing high-frequency, wide dynamic range signals. This component is part of the LTC2293 series, which includes the LTC2292 and LTC2291, offering sample rates of 65Msps, 40Msps, and 25Msps respectively. The LTC2293CUP is particularly suited for demanding imaging and communications applications due to its excellent AC performance, including a signal-to-noise ratio (SNR) of 71.3dB and a spurious free dynamic range (SFDR) of 90dB at the Nyquist frequency.

Key Features

  • Integrated Dual 12-Bit ADCs with pipelined architecture
  • Single 3V supply (2.7V to 3.4V) for low power operation
  • Multiplexed or separate data bus options
  • Flexible input range: 1V P-P to 2V P-P
  • Optional clock duty cycle stabilizer for high performance across various clock duty cycles
  • Shutdown and nap modes for power management
  • Simultaneous sampling capability
  • Separate output supply to drive 0.5V to 3.6V logic
